Cottage Grove, Wisconsin

Population: 1,131
Located in Dane County

The Town of Cottage Grove was originally a part of the Town of Madison. On February 11,1847, the Town of Cottage Grove was created. This town also included the Town of Deerfield and the two were separated on April 20,1849. The Town received its name from a beautiful grove of burr oaks in the midst of which William C. Wells built his house in 1840. This house was the tavern and post office of the Town for many years. The Village of Cottage Grove was incorporated on September 5, 1924.

Cottage Grove is and excellent spot for those of you who enjoy outdoor recreation. We are located within minutes of prime hunting and fishing spots. The Glacial Drumlin Trail runs through the heart of Cottage Grove, offering a natural escape for outdoor enthusiasts. On any given day in the spring, summer, fall or winter the Trail is used by cyclists enjoying a scenic ride, people enjoying a walk with nature or snowmobilers enjoying a trouble-free cruise.
